Crown molding installation services involve attaching decorative trim along the upper edges of interior walls, typically where the wall meets the ceiling. This process enhances the aesthetic appeal of a room by adding architectural detail and a finished look. Skilled installers measure, cut, and securely affix crown molding to ensure proper alignment and a seamless appearance. The service may also include filling gaps, sanding, and painting or staining to match the existing decor, resulting in a polished and refined interior space.

Material and Design Costs - The cost of crown molding installation typically ranges from $4 to $20 per linear foot, depending on the material and complexity of the design. For example, simple MDF moldings may be closer to the lower end, while intricate wood designs can be at the higher end.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ific choices.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ing crown molding generally fall between $2 and $8 per linear foot. Factors influencing this include ceiling height, room size, and the intricacy of the installation. Contact local service providers for detailed quotes tailored to specific projects.

Project Size and Scope - Larger or more complex projects tend to increase overall costs, with total expenses often ranging from $200 to $2,000 per room. Larger rooms or custom moldings may require additional time and materials, impacting the final price. Local contractors can evaluate project scope for accurate pricing.

Additional Costs - Additional expenses may include removal of existing moldings, wall repairs, or painting, which can add $50 to $300 or more per room. These costs vary based on the existing condition and desired finish. Local pros can outline potential extra charges during consultation.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is crown molding installation? Crown molding installation involves attaching decorative trim to the upper corners where walls meet ceilings to enhance the room's appearance.

How long does crown molding installation typically take? The duration of installation varies depending on the room size and complexity, but local pros can provide estimates during consultation.

What types of crown molding materials are available? Common materials include wood, plaster, polyurethane, and polystyrene, each offering different styles and finishes.

Can crown molding be installed in rooms with irregular ceilings? Yes, experienced contractors can adapt crown molding to fit ceilings with various angles or irregularities for a seamless look.

Is preparation needed before crown molding installation? It's recommended to clear the area and ensure walls and ceilings are clean and free of obstructions for proper installation.
